Regarding: Boat part number 8105360 is a new deck hatch from Pompanette, part number G71020-11TMT . Commonly used on Tracker boats, part number 179359 .
Is this deck hatch constructed in such a way that it can be walked on?
Is this deck hatch constructed in such a way that it can be walked on?
Question by: Dennis Kelly on May 23, 2021, 1:21 PM
Hello Dennis,
Yes, it can, but it is recommended to partially step on the frame as well as the door. It'll support the weight but it's just kind of a given that's what it best when it comes to plastic hatches.

is this hatch watertight?
Question by: Louis Ariante on Aug 20, 2022, 3:03 PM
Hello Louis,
It is designed to withstand normal spray and rain, but they are not considered "watertight." None of the deck hatches we have are considered truly watertight.
